How it's used
Proper nouns for institutions in Hong Kong often follow a specific naming convention where the location or entity precedes the type of facility. When giving directions or making plans, locals frequently refer to this specific location by its full name to distinguish it from other cultural venues nearby like the Hong Kong Cultural Centre.
